Should I use clear or obscured glass for my shower enclosure?
Nothing opens up a bathroom like a clear glass frameless closure, especially if you have a small bathroom. It is all a matter of opinion, whether you prefer your privacy or are looking to open up space.
-
What is the difference between semi-frameless and frameless shower enclosures?
Frameless enclosures have minimal hardware while with semi-frameless enclosures any fixed panels are fully framed.
-
What thickness of glass is used on a frameless shower enclosure?
Frameless enclosures range from 3/8 " thru 1/2' tempered glass.

If my double pane window has only one side broken, can that one side be re-glazed?
No, once the seal of a double pane window is compromised a new sealed unit must be installed.
